#17931e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17931e is composed of 9% red, 57.6%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 123.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#17931e color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ff3c with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#17931e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17931e has RGB values of R:23, G:147,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1544990.

Shades and Tints of #17931e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b02 is the darkest color, while #f9f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#17931e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525852 is the less saturated color, while #03a70d is the most saturated one.
